Ok, Gopalakrishnan, there are also some useful circuits, I admit, but only in the hand of an experienced person! It's nothing for a beginner, just because he is unable to decide whether it's dangerous or not!! The beginner cannot estimate what's wrong and right, and that's the extreme danger... I remember very well, when I started in electronics. And I can tell you, that I was totally stupid in that sense and indeed run into fatal dangers from time to time. Beginners URGENTLY NEED guidance in saftey issues, need repeating safety rules over and over again. Just to warn "Take care fatal voltages are produced in this circuit" isn't sufficient at all!! So, I'm very sceptical with such sites. Kai |
